Le cannabidiol est un composé organique terpénique naturel de la famille des cannabinoïdes présent dans la plante de Chanvre. Il a été découvert en 1940 et fait partie des plus de 100 cannabinoïdes découverts. Wikipédia
DCI : cannabidiol
Formule : C21H30O2;
Masse molaire : 314,461 7 ± 0,019 5 g/mol; C 80,21 %, H 9,62 %, O 10,18 %
No CAS : 13956-29-1
No ECHA : 100.215.986
Nom UICPA : 2--5-pentylbenzène-1,3-diol
PubChem : 644019
